Fragmented Beauty: Exploring the Timeless Allure of the “Three Graces” through a Cubist Lens

“Three Graces” presents a contemporary interpretation of the classical figures, rendered in a vibrant, cubist style. The three female figures, traditionally representing charm, beauty, and creativity, are depicted in a dynamic composition of fragmented forms and intersecting planes. 

The artist’s palette is rich and varied, with warm earth tones blending seamlessly with splashes of cool blues and greens, creating a sense of both harmony and energy. The figures are intertwined, their bodies echoing the natural forms of the surrounding foliage and rocky outcrop. 

This piece recalls the works of renowned cubist artists such as Pablo Picasso, Georges Braque, and Juan Gris, while also forging a unique and expressive artistic voice. The influence of Paul Cézanne’s structured landscapes can also be observed in the treatment of the natural elements.
